Does the AF use 1000lb bombs at all??

The F-22 does. As far as I know though, they are the only one. There is no reason why the F-15E couldn't carry them, they just wouldn't. The AF does not have 1,000 pound bombs in thier "regular" inventory, and haven't since around the Vietnam timeframe.

Were the F-15E to carry them, they would be limited to LCT-1, LCT-3, RCT-1, RCT-3 (the front and back lower CFT pylons) and stations 2,5,8 (wing and centerline stations) as those are currently the only pylons wired for "smart" weapons at this time.

In addition, like any other store they would have to go through computer and flight testing to ensure that their carriage and release present no problems. That costs money.
